Abstract
The phosphate complex of sulphite oxidase in the Mo(V) oxidation state was investigated by e.p.r. spectroscopy. Third-derivative spectra reveal a wealth of structural detail previously unobserved in this spectrum. Most notable is the presence of hyperfine coupling from two inequivalent I = 1/2 nuclei, which we tentatively attribute to two 31P nuclei. Unresolved hyperfine interactions from at least one exchangeable 1H nucleus are also present.Entities:
